Comprehending Car Key ShellsWhat is a Car Key Shell?
A car key shell is the external case of a car key that houses the internal systems, such as the transponder chip and the key blade. These shells can be made from different products, including plastic and metal, depending on the vehicle's make and design.

Assess the Damage: Inspect the key shell for cracks, breaks, or any other problems. Identify if a simple repair will suffice or if a full replacement is required.

Dismantle the Key: Use a screwdriver to thoroughly open the existing key shell. Keep in mind of how the internal parts are placed.

Clean the Components: Gently tidy the internal parts and eliminate any dirt or grime with rubbing alcohol and a microfiber cloth. This will help avoid any hindrance during reassembly.

Fixing Minor Damage: For small cracks, use very glue thoroughly. Hold the pieces together until the glue sets. If buttons are malfunctioning, guarantee any worn-out or separated buttons are fixed or changed.

Reassemble the Key: Carefully position the internal components back into the brand-new or fixed shell. Make certain they sit firmly and align properly.

Evaluate the Key: After reassembling, evaluate the type in the ignition and check all buttons to ensure functionality.

How much does it cost to change a car key shell?
The cost of a car key shell can differ widely based upon the make and model of the vehicle. Typically, it varies from ₤ 10 to ₤ 100, not including programming services for transponder chips.
2. Can I repair my key shell myself?
Yes, many small repairs can be performed at home with the right tools and materials. Nevertheless, if the damage is extensive or you feel uneasy with the procedure, looking for professional help is advisable.
3. How can I inform if my key shell is beyond repair?
If your key shell has considerable fractures, numerous broken pieces, or the internal elements are misaligned and not secure, it may be time for a replacement.
4. Do I need to reprogram my key after changing the shell?
Most of the times, if you're just replacing the shell and not the internal electronic devices, reprogramming is not required. Nevertheless, if the transponder chip is likewise damaged, programming may be needed.
5. Where can I purchase a replacement key shell?
Replacement key shells can be purchased from automotive sellers, locksmith professionals, or online markets such as Amazon or eBay.
